ORIGINAL: Rizzox58

Does anyone know how to paint the brake part red, it seems ricerish but i like it somewhat...whats that called anyways? thanks!
Unbolt the "calipers" and use a brite color of your choice high temp engine paint from the local auto parts. Be sure to clean it really good before hand or you'll be doing it again real soon. You could do it with a paintbrush by spraying the engine paint into the cap and brushing it on and only painting the part that shows withought removing the "calipers". Kinda Ghetto that way though.
